Abhishek Bachchan
Abhishek Bachchan, born on February 5, 1976, in Mumbai, Maharashtra, is a prominent Indian actor and producer. As the son of legendary actors Amitabh Bachchan and Jaya Bachchan, he has grown up in the limelight. Abhishek tied the knot with the renowned actress and former Miss World, Aishwarya Rai, further cementing his place in the cinematic elite.
He made his acting debut in 2000 with J.P. Dutta's film *Refugee*, but it was his roles in 2004 that truly marked his arrival in Bollywood. His performances in the hit movie *Dhoom* and the critically lauded *Yuva* garnered significant attention, with *Yuva* also earning him his first Filmfare Award for Best Supporting Actor. This accolade was a precursor to two more Filmfare wins in the following years.
In 2010, Abhishek expanded his talents to production, earning his first National Film Award for his work on the film *Paa*, which claimed the title of Best Feature Film in Hindi. Throughout his career, he has featured in various successful films such as *Bunty aur Babli*, *Guru*, and *Dostana*, solidifying his status as one of the leading figures in the Indian film industry.
